So I am new so be kind please as I do not know much about Nissan engines. When I shift gears there is a lot of rev hang. It makes me want to wait between gears. None of my other manual cars do this. the only thing that was close to this was my 2016 WRX which i no longer own. Is this just the way the engine works or is there a way to lessen this feature?
I don't notice any with my '04 6MT sedan or my '02 6MT Maxima. I know Honda/Acuras have an issue with this and it's a check ball in the hydraulic system that can be removed. Don't know about Infiniti having that though.
Check for any vacuum leaks. Intake pipe as well as the three hoses on the PCV system. If you can turn the hoses by hand they're probably leaking.
